Abstract:
The best reliability estimate obtained from a finite sample of time intervals taken from an exponential distribution has previously been derived. Instead of solving an integral equation, this result can readily be obtained by dividing an interval of fixed length in a random fashion and considering the resulting subinterval statistics.
